Wisconsin Roasted Corn
Report
Roasted corn on the grill that tastes just as good as the State Fair corn on the cob!Yield: As many ears of corn as you feel like roasting!

Ingredients
- 4 plump ears Wisconsin sweet corn (yes, we are bias)
- Optional toppings: butter, salt, season salt, pepper
Instructions
- While the grill coals are heating, submerge your corn in cold water. Leave to soak 15 -30 min.
- Place the corn on the grill, avoiding any intense hot pockets, and cover.
- Check corn every 5 minutes or so to be sure nothing is burning and your coals are still hot.
- Once the husks start to dry out, and you have nice grill lines on the bottom side, flip the ears. Repeat the same process with this side.
- The corn is done when the outer husks have dried out.
